1. Spain’s Renewable Energy Landscape: A Snapshot
Spain’s journey towards renewable energy dominance began in the early 2000s, driven by the need to reduce greenhouse gas emissions and dependence on fossil fuels. Today, Spain is one of the top producers of renewable energy in Europe, with wind, solar, and hydropower leading the charge.
Wind Energy: Harnessing the Power of the Wind
Spain is the second-largest producer of wind energy in Europe, after Germany. The country’s wind farms generate a significant portion of its electricity, thanks to its favorable geographic location and consistent wind patterns. The Spanish government has invested heavily in wind energy infrastructure, resulting in a robust network of wind turbines across the country.
Solar Energy: Tapping into the Sun’s Potential
Spain is also a leader in solar energy, particularly in photovoltaic (PV) and concentrated solar power (CSP) technologies. The country’s sunny climate makes it an ideal location for solar farms, which have seen exponential growth in recent years. Spain’s innovative approach to solar energy includes the development of floating solar farms and solar thermal plants, which store energy for use during non-sunny periods.
Hydropower: Leveraging Water Resources
Hydropower has long been a staple of Spain’s energy mix, providing a reliable and renewable source of electricity. The country’s numerous rivers and reservoirs enable the generation of hydroelectric power, which complements other renewable sources. Spain is also exploring pumped-storage hydropower, a technology that stores excess energy by pumping water uphill and releasing it to generate electricity when needed.
2. Government Policies and Incentives: Driving the Renewable Energy Boom
Spain’s success in renewable energy can be attributed to its supportive government policies and incentives. The Spanish government has implemented a range of measures to promote the adoption of renewable energy technologies, including feed-in tariffs, tax incentives, and grants for research and development.
Feed-in Tariffs: Encouraging Investment
Feed-in tariffs (FITs) have played a crucial role in Spain’s renewable energy boom. These tariffs guarantee a fixed price for renewable energy fed into the grid, providing a stable income for producers and encouraging investment in renewable energy projects. The FIT scheme has been particularly effective in promoting solar and wind energy, leading to a surge in installations across the country.
Tax Incentives: Reducing the Cost of Renewable Energy
The Spanish government offers various tax incentives to reduce the cost of renewable energy projects. These incentives include tax credits, exemptions, and deductions for companies and individuals investing in renewable energy. By lowering the financial barriers to entry, these incentives have made renewable energy more accessible and attractive to a wider range of investors.
Research and Development: Fostering Innovation
Spain is committed to fostering innovation in renewable energy through research and development (R&D). The government provides grants and funding for R&D projects, enabling companies and research institutions to develop new technologies and improve existing ones. This focus on innovation has led to breakthroughs in areas such as energy storage, grid integration, and efficiency, further solidifying Spain’s position as a leader in renewable energy.
3. Technological Advancements: Pushing the Boundaries of Renewable Energy
Spain’s leadership in renewable energy is also driven by its technological advancements. The country is home to some of the most innovative renewable energy technologies in the world, which are helping to push the boundaries of what is possible in the sector.
Floating Solar Farms: Maximizing Solar Potential
One of the most exciting developments in Spain’s renewable energy sector is the advent of floating solar farms. These solar farms are installed on bodies of water, such as reservoirs and lakes, maximizing the use of available space and reducing land use conflicts. Floating solar farms also benefit from the cooling effect of water, which increases the efficiency of the solar panels. Spain’s first floating solar farm, located in the Sierra Brava reservoir, is a testament to the country’s innovative approach to solar energy.
Energy Storage: Addressing Intermittency
Energy storage is a critical component of Spain’s renewable energy strategy, addressing the intermittency of solar and wind power. The country is investing in advanced battery technologies, such as lithium-ion and flow batteries, to store excess energy generated during peak production periods. This stored energy can then be released during periods of high demand or low production, ensuring a stable and reliable energy supply.
Smart Grids: Enhancing Grid Integration
Spain is also at the forefront of smart grid technology, which enhances the integration of renewable energy into the grid. Smart grids use advanced sensors, communication technologies, and data analytics to optimize the distribution and consumption of electricity. This technology enables real-time monitoring and control of the grid, improving efficiency, reliability, and resilience. Spain’s smart grid initiatives are helping to accommodate the growing share of renewable energy in the country’s energy mix.

5. Challenges and Future Prospects: Sustaining the Momentum
While Spain has made remarkable progress in renewable energy, it faces several challenges that must be addressed to sustain its momentum.
Grid Infrastructure: Upgrading for the Future
One of the key challenges facing Spain’s renewable energy sector is the need to upgrade its grid infrastructure. The existing grid was designed for centralized fossil fuel power plants, and integrating a large share of decentralized renewable energy requires significant upgrades. Spain is investing in grid modernization projects, but more work is needed to ensure the grid can handle the increasing share of renewable energy.
Public Acceptance: Building Support for Renewable Energy
Public acceptance is another challenge for Spain’s renewable energy sector. While there is broad support for renewable energy, some communities have raised concerns about the visual impact of wind turbines and solar farms, as well as the potential impact on wildlife. Addressing these concerns through community engagement and careful planning is essential to building public support for renewable energy projects.
Policy Stability: Ensuring Long-Term Commitment
Policy stability is critical to the continued growth of Spain’s renewable energy sector. Changes in government policies and incentives can create uncertainty for investors and hinder the development of new projects. Ensuring long-term commitment to renewable energy through stable and predictable policies is essential to sustaining the sector’s growth.
